Patti Lupone's achievements as a singer and actress are too numerable to mention. Born in 1949, she won a Tony Award for Eva Peron in "Evita." Her Fantine in "Les Miserables", and Norma Desmond in "Sunset Boulevard" were enormously successful as well.
Lupone joined John Houseman's "The Acting Company" in '72 and stayed through '76. In รข??85, she won an Olivier Award for her work in Blitztein's musical, "The Cradle Will Rock." Her one-woman show won an Outer Circle Award, and she debuted in "Seven Deadly Sins," the last collaboration of Weill and Brecht, at the New York City Ballet. She refers to her time playing Evita as a horrible experience.
